Output 63134bba3bb461c7dc21de9a04f8695475e9da403ca9acec48d4af1ef047bd56:1

value
1086482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a24ed37eb74c33de761523575003b3835c83cda6 OP_EQUAL
address
3GVDpZHDCHvZJ1X7GjbFm6fUucYwwNyBpX
transaction
63134bba3bb461c7dc21de9a04f8695475e9da403ca9acec48d4af1ef047bd56
spent
true